For the 2024 school year, there are 3 public schools serving 866 students in Fort Huachuca Accommodation District (4167) School District. This district's average testing ranking is 9/10, which is in the top 20% of public schools in Arizona.
Public Schools in Fort Huachuca Accommodation District (4167) School District have an average math proficiency score of 59% (versus the Arizona public school average of 31%), and reading proficiency score of 62% (versus the 39% statewide average).
Minority enrollment is 49%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Arizona public school average of 64% (majority Hispanic).

District Revenue and Spending

The revenue/student of $16,359 is higher than the state median of $11,274. The school district revenue/student has stayed relatively flat over four school years.
The school district's spending/student of $13,476 is higher than the state median of $11,177. The school district spending/student has grown by 8% over four school years.
